Precision Livestock Farming: IoT technology enables dairy farmers to monitor and collect real-time data about their cattle, such as individual health, milk production, and feeding patterns. By employing wearable devices such as smart collars or ear tags, sensors can track vital signs, detect diseases, and monitor the overall well-being of each cow. This data-driven approach allows farmers to make informed decisions and take timely actions, ultimately improving the overall health and productivity of the herd. 2. Automated Milking Systems: Traditionally, milking cows was a labor-intensive task that required manual intervention. IoT technology has revolutionized the process by introducing automated milking systems. These systems use robotic arms equipped with sensors to identify and attach teat cups to the cows, ensuring a comfortable and stress-free process. The sensors can also monitor milk quality, production volume, and detect any anomalies, enabling farmers to optimize milk production and maintain the highest quality standards. 3. Smart Feeding Systems: Feeding cows is a crucial task for dairy farmers. With IoT technology, smart feeding systems can be implemented to optimize the feeding process. Sensors embedded in the feeding equipment can monitor the consumption patterns of individual cows and adjust their diets accordingly. This ensures that each cow receives the right amount and type of feed, leading to improved digestion, health, and milk production. Moreover, IoT enables farmers to remotely control and schedule feeding tasks, reducing manual efforts and saving valuable time. 4. Environmental Monitoring: IoT technology can also enhance environmental monitoring on dairy farms. Sensors can collect data on temperature, humidity, air quality, and detect any potential risks or abnormalities in the barn environment. This information helps farmers maintain optimal conditions for their cattle, preventing diseases and improving animal welfare. Additionally, IoT can automate ventilation and cooling systems, ensuring a comfortable and stress-free environment for the cows. 5. Data Analytics and Predictive Analytics: The massive amount of data collected through IoT devices can be processed and analyzed using advanced analytics tools. By leveraging data analytics and predictive analytics techniques, dairy farmers can gain valuable insights into cow performance, health trends, and milk production patterns. This empowers them to make informed decisions, optimize breeding strategies, prevent diseases, and improve overall farm management.
